§ 25.0915 — TRUANCY PREVENTION MEASURES
ED § 25.0915Title 2. PUBLIC EDUCATION · Part E. STUDENTS AND PARENTS · Ch. 25. ADMISSION, TRANSFER, AND ATTENDANCE · Art. C. OPERATION OF SCHOOLS AND SCHOOL ATTENDANCE
Statute text
View on source(a)A school district shall adopt truancy prevention measures designed to:
(1)address student conduct related to truancy in the school setting before the student engages in conduct described by Section 65.003(a), Family Code; and
(2)minimize the need for referrals to truancy court for conduct described by Section 65.003(a), Family Code. (a-1) As a truancy prevention measure under Subsection (a), a school district shall take one or more of the following actions:
(1)impose:
(A)a behavior improvement plan on the student that must be signed by an employee of the school, that the school district has made a good faith effort to have signed by the student and the student's parent or guardian, and that includes:
(i)a specific description of the behavior that is required or prohibited for the student;

Legislative history
Acts 2013, 83rd Leg., R.S., Ch. 1407 (S.B. 393), Sec. 8, eff. September 1, 2013. Acts 2013, 83rd Leg., R.S., Ch. 1409 (S.B. 1114), Sec. 2, eff. September 1, 2013. Acts 2015, 84th Leg., R.S., Ch. 935 (H.B. 2398), Sec. 9, eff. September 1, 2015. Acts 2021, 87th Leg., R.S., Ch. 314 (H.B. 699), Sec. 3, eff. June 7, 2021.
